Output 2e6d76a94434ac24083ef802b755b1c1fe5d0d723375d5b70ef0a90d6be97da1:7

value
17449272
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 09773e770386985a48a2e22b4f82fffed66b96f39373f43b68d6a5fb7149091e
address
tb1pp9mnuacrs6v95j9zug45lqhllmtxh9hnjdelgwmg66jlku2fpy0qs22fw9
transaction
2e6d76a94434ac24083ef802b755b1c1fe5d0d723375d5b70ef0a90d6be97da1
confirmations
21896
spent
true